About the sica, in our tests we have found exactly what John has. The sica is a great weapon for a pulling draw across the back or back of the arms of the opponent. When hold the scutum in against your body it is almost impossible to be cut, however if the opponent is armed with a sica they can almost draw against you with impunity if you hold the shield in this manner. There are a lot of points about this, but the thread would be too long, but in general the above holds true, the sica does indeed seem to have been a horribly crafty variation of weapon.<br>
